My Unique Approach: Transpersonal Depth Psychotherapy

With over 15 years of experience as a yoga and meditation teacher, including extensive time spent in India with spiritual teachers, my work as a psychotherapist whilst grounded in presence, mindfulness, and compassion, is ultimately rooted in the transpersonal dimension. This perspective invites an exploration of inner landscapes that honours not only the psychological and psychodynamic approaches to therapy but also the spiritual aspects of one’s being.

Drawing on my background in yoga, meditation, and Authentic Relating practices, such as Focussing and Circling, I offer a safe and attuned space for  clients to explore their experiences in a way that encompasses a wider understanding of consciousness and the human journey.

This depth-oriented work is supported by Core Process Psychotherapy, which integrates Eastern contemplative wisdom with Western psychodynamic understanding.
 

Rather than focusing solely on immediate challenges, our work together has the scope to explore your life as a whole, uncovering the parts of you that may lie in the shadows. It is an invitation to remember who you truly are, to see your struggles as part of a much wider unfolding and to find your unique expression in the world with a renewed sense of wholeness. 

I often guide clients to tune into their body’s subtle cues using awareness of their somatic sensations. Together, we bring attention to how emotional patterns live in breath, posture and sensation, allowing space for held experiences to emerge and release. This attuned, body-based process supports integration without re-traumatisation and helps restore a felt sense of safety from within.

This means I offer a space where you are gently supported to explore your inner world at your own pace, while also being encouraged to inquire into the unconscious patterns and formative experiences that may be shaping your life.

Having undertaken many years of dedicated yogic and contemplative practice, mindfulness is not simply a technique I use but a quality I aim to embody. This foundation supports a therapeutic presence that is steady, grounded, and attuned.

Clients often describe me as calm and non-judgemental. At the same time, I am able to gently challenge my clients to reflect on beliefs, behaviours and ways of relating that may no longer serve their growth. I believe that meaningful change arises from this balance between compassionate holding and honest inquiry.

I welcome people from all walks of life who are seeking emotional, psychological or spiritual transformation.
